HIPAA Privacy and Security Assessment

The Boston Public Health Commission (BPHC) is an independent agency that provides accessible community-based health services including education, emergency medical services, and resources that contribute to promoting health equity.

To uphold the organization’s mission and ensure the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of Information systems, and client protected health information (PHI), BPHC is seeking proposals from experienced and qualified organizations to perform a comprehensive Information Security and HIPAA Risk Assessment that is fully aligned with industry standard security frameworks and HIPAA Privacy and Security Rules.
